Is Soft Delicious Fancy Cake, Vanilla good for weight loss?

This cake is calorie-dense at 90 calories per ounce, making it challenging for weight loss goals since portion control becomes difficult. The high sugar content (6g per serving) and low protein (1g) mean it won't keep you satisfied for long, which can lead to overeating.

Is Soft Delicious Fancy Cake, Vanilla a good snack for kids?

Kids typically enjoy the vanilla flavor and sweet taste, though the hazelnut and cocoa ingredients mean you should verify no allergies first. It's fine as an occasional treat, but the low nutritional value makes it better suited as dessert rather than a snack.

What diets does Soft Delicious Fancy Cake, Vanilla suit?

It works within keto or low-carb diets only in very small portions due to 11g carbs per serving. This cake is generally not suitable for strict sugar-restricted or paleo diets given its refined sugar and vegetable oil base.

What does Soft Delicious Fancy Cake, Vanilla pair well with for a balanced meal?

Serve it with fresh fruit like berries or strawberries to add fiber and vitamins. A glass of milk or unsweetened tea balances the sweetness without overwhelming the palate.

How does Soft Delicious Fancy Cake, Vanilla fit into a balanced diet?

This cake works best as an occasional dessert in small portions rather than a regular dietary staple. To balance a meal that includes it, pair with protein-rich foods and vegetables to add nutritional value that the cake itself lacks.
